Happy Mojo Monday!  For the last week of the month, we like to mix things up and focus on non-traditional sized cards.  So since it's Round or Square week try a round card, a square card or both if you're feeling really inspired!!  {If you're not sure how to make a round card, I described my process in the 2nd paragraph of this post on my blog a few months ago.} 


This week's sketch may look tricky, but I promise it's easy "piece-y"! {grin}  The background is just a square cut into quarters along the diagonal so that you have four triangles. Then flip over two opposing sides and piece back together with tape. For the circle sketch, do the same thing, then just cut your circle from your pieced together square.
